casing technique hypothesis - no casing damage!
    #2439532 - 03/16/04 01:40 PM (20 years, 17 days ago)

I just had an idea, a jar of grain that I had recently forgotten, sitting on the shelf, with its coffee filter stuffed inside to keep it out of the way. I noticed a shroom growing upon said coffee filter.
so not one to waste a good shroom, I harvested said shroom and noted with much joy easy how easily it seperated from the coffee filter.

My hypothesis is this : to prevent damage to the casing from the removal of shrooms place substrate material into container like normal and cover with 75% of your normal casing amount, then place in some coffee filters to act as a -tear-away- barrier then cover with an additiona 25% of your casing layer.

The idea being that the pins form *above* the tear away layer, and so when you go to pull them, thier attachment is no-where near as strong to the fiberous material of the filter.

I'm going to try this on my next casing...
